Abstract:
The existing volume and increasing growth rate of documented information has resulted in numerous efforts to construct operational document storage and retrieval systems, as a practical solution to the demand for information storage and retrieval. Accompanying the surge to build more and better and bigger Document Retrieval Systems DRSs, was the realization that there are few effective tools for the designers and managers of these systems. The tasks of design and management of DRSs requires tools and performance measures to aid in the selection of preferred options, and in the control over the fundamental processes of inquiry analysis, indexing, retrieval and system growth. A step toward the generation of operational tools to aid in the design and management tasks is presented. Modified author abstract
